We’re looking for an experienced **Vendor Risk & Relationship Manager****** to own and strengthen critical third‑party partnerships within a highly regulated environment. This role sits at the intersection of procurement, risk and relationship management—ideal for someone who can confidently challenge vendors while maintaining strong, trusted partnerships. You’ll play a key role in ensuring suppliers meet regulatory obligations (including CPS230), while managing risk, performance and governance across the vendor lifecycle. You’ll take accountability for the full vendor lifecycle, ensuring suppliers meet regulatory obligations (including CPS230) while delivering strong commercial and operational outcomes. From onboarding and risk assessments through to performance management and contract renewal, you’ll play a key role in protecting the organisation and optimising vendor value. This is a hands-on role that requires balance—someone who enjoys building relationships and having robust, honest conversations with suppliers, but is equally comfortable spending time in the detail.
